The match ended in contoversy, stumps being called 40 minutes early after the South Canterbury captain, E Fowler, objected to the number of people transgressing on the ground. According to the Timaru Herald this was not so and it was probably because it was so cold that the captain wanted to get his players off the field as the English XI had won. This course of events led to bad feeling between the public and their home team.
